Music in Kilkenny Concert : Vanbrugh & Friends

PROGRAMME & PERFORMERS
Keith Pascoe – violin : Marja Gaynor – violin : Simon Aspell – viola : Ed Creedon – viola : Christopher Marwood – cello
Wolfgang Amadeus Mozart String Quintet No. 6 in Eb Major, K. 614
Johannes Brahms String Quintet No. 1 in F Major, op. 88
Felix Mendelssohn String Quintet No. 2 in Bb Major, op. 87
Mozart always brings charm, elegance and wit, however harsh his circumstances, and nowhere more so than in his gorgeous E flat major string quintet, written in the last year of his short life along with the Magic Flute, the clarinet concerto and the Requiem.
Brahms wrote his F major quintet ‘in the spring of 1882’ and the resulting nickname of ‘Spring’ Quintet is perfect for this extraordinarily uplifting, fresh and joyful music.
The irrepressibly virtuosic outer movements of Mendelssohn’s B flat quintet offer great contrast to an elegantly playful scherzo and perhaps the highlight of the work, the anguished and yet profoundly beautiful Funeral March.
